Coroner: One Killed When Truck Crashes into Bus

ROLLING PRAIRIE, Ind. (AP): Authorities say one person was killed and more than a dozen were injured when a pickup truck crashed into a charter bus along a northern Indiana highway.

 

The LaPorte County coroner says the driver of the pickup truck died about 3 p.m. EST Wednesday when he lost control of his truck and it crashed into a Royal Excursion charter bus along U.S. 20.

Fifteen people were injured in the crash, but none of those injuries were life-threatening. The bus slid off the roadway after the crash in eastern LaPorte County.

The charter bus was carrying people to or from the Four Winds Casino in New Buffalo, Mich.

The crash occurred near U.S. 20's intersection with County Road 450 East.
